Yahoo Cards and Panthers preview


Catweisers

Recommended Posts

Rivera's defense paved the way in the team's first shutout since 2008, allowing 150 total yards after giving up 806 in the previous two weeks. The Panthers also sacked Eli Manning seven times and forced three turnovers despite playing without four starters on defense and missing four defensive backs.

 

http://sports.yahoo.com/news/panthers-cardinals-preview-182259023--nfl.html
